Top officials in San Mateo are giving up some benefits in an effort to curb the city’s escalating pension and health insurance costs.
The city manager, police and fire chiefs and other top officials have agreed to pay a portion of their own retirement pension and health insurance benefit costs to save the city roughly $160,000 a year.
